The Ebisu doll is a traditional Japanese good-luck charm that represents the God of Fishermen and Luck, Ebisu. It is often displayed in homes and businesses to bring prosperity and success.

Key Features

  • Handcrafted from ceramics or wood
  • Depicts the deity Ebisu holding a sea bream or fishing rod
  • Colorful and intricately designed
